Which side of the plane to sit from Southwest Florida International Airport (Fort Myers) to George Bush Intercontinental Houston Airport (Houston)?
Left Side of the Plane
The left side offers the most iconic views of Florida's barrier islands immediately after takeoff and typically provides a better angle for the Texas coastline and Galveston Bay during the descent into Houston.
Sanibel & Captiva Islands
Stunning aerial views of these famous shell-shaped barrier islands and their white sand beaches right after departure.
Gulf of Mexico
Vast stretches of deep blue water often featuring sun glint and occasional sightings of large cargo vessels.
Offshore Oil Rigs
Distant industrial structures appearing as tiny specks in the deep waters of the western Gulf.
Galveston Island
A clear view of the historic seawall, Pleasure Pier, and the sandy beaches of the Texas coast during descent.
Houston Ship Channel
One of the busiest ports in the world, visible with massive tankers and intricate industrial infrastructure.
Sit on the left for the best sunrise/sunset views depending on your flight time, as the sun will be to the south/southwest. For the best view of the Florida islands, ensure you have a window seat clear of the wing, ideally in the first or last third of the cabin.
